Position: 25-26 Secondary Teachers Vicksburg High School

TITLE:

Secondary Teacher

REPORTS TO:

Building Principal

JOB GOAL:
To teach students in a manner that they can apply the knowledge and skills required for College and Career Readiness in accordance with the Mississippi Framework and Common Core Curriculum.

SUPERVISORY RESPONSIBILITY:
Students and their learning.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:
  • Develops and implements plans for the curriculum program assigned and shows written evidence of preparation as required.
  • Prepares lessons that reflect accommodations for individual differences.
  • Presents the subject matter according to guidelines established by MDE and the district.
  • Plans and uses appropriate instructional/learning strategies, activities, materials, and equipment that reflect accommodation for individual needs of students assigned.
  • Conducts assessment of student learning styles and uses results for instructional activities.
  • Works cooperatively with special education teachers to modify curricula as needed for special education students.
  • Cooperates with other members of the staff in planning and implementing instructional goals, objectives, and methods according to state/district requirements.
  • Plans and supervises purposeful assignments for teacher aide(s) and/or volunteer(s).
  • Uses technologies in the teaching/learning process.
  • Assists students in analyzing and improving methods and habits of study.
  • Consistently assesses student achievement through formal and informal testing.
  • Assumes responsibility for extracurricular activities as assigned and may sponsor outside activities approved by the school administrator.
  • Implements the strategies outlined by the district.
  • Instructs students in citizenship and basic subject matter.
  • Presents a positive role model for students that supports the mission of the school.
  • Creates a classroom environment conducive to learning and appropriate to the physical, social, and emotional development of students.
  • Uses a variety of instruction strategies, such as inquiry, group discussion, cooperative learning, lecture, discovery, etc.
  • Manages student behavior in the classroom and administers discipline according to board policy and administrative regulations.
  • Takes necessary and reasonable precautions to protect students, equipment, materials, and facilities.
  • Assists in the selection of books, equipment, and other instructional materials.
  • Evaluates students’ academic and social growth, keeps appropriate records, and prepares progress reports.
  • Establishes and maintains open lines of communication with parents and students.
  • Uses acceptable communication skills to present information accurately and clearly.
  • Identifies student needs and cooperates with other professional staff members in assessing and helping students solve health, attitude, and learning problems.
  • Maintains professional competence through in-service education activities provided by professional growth activities.
  • Participates cooperatively with the appropriate administrator to develop the method by which the teacher will be evaluated in conformance with state/district guidelines.
  • Supervises students in out-of-classroom activities during the day and on all field lessons.
  • Administers group standardized tests in accordance with state/district testing programs.
  • Participates in Professional Learning Communities, faculty committees/meetings, and the sponsorship of student activities.
  • Uses student data to guide instruction and professional development.
  • Other duties as assigned.
QUALIFICATIONS:

Bachelor’s degree from an accredited college or university;
Experience preferred but not required. Possession of (or eligible for) a valid regular Mississippi teaching certificate.

TERMS OF EMPLOYMENT:

187 Days
